Iranian news agencies reported that a US ship was attacked by missiles, heightening tensions in the Strait of Hormuz. In response, the US Department of Defense (Pentagon) denied these allegations, raising questions about the deteriorating security situation in the region.

These events come at a sensitive time, as Iran warned that any US intervention in the Strait of Hormuz constitutes a violation of the ceasefire. President Donald Trump announced an operation aimed at securing the passage of commercial vessels from neutral countries through the region, complicating the security landscape further.

Details of the Incident

According to reports, Iran claimed that the US ship was attacked by missiles while in the Strait of Hormuz, a vital waterway through which approximately 20% of the world's oil passes. In contrast, Washington confirmed that it had not received any reports of such an attack, casting doubt on the accuracy of the Iranian information.

This incident occurs amid escalating tensions between Iran and the United States, with both countries exchanging accusations regarding military activities in the region. Iranian officials indicated that US intervention in the Strait of Hormuz could lead to an escalation of the conflict, threatening regional stability.

Background & Context

Historically, the Strait of Hormuz is considered a strategic point in the world, as a significant portion of oil exports passes through it. The region has witnessed numerous military incidents in recent years, exacerbating tensions between Iran and Western countries, particularly the United States.

In recent years, the United States has imposed economic sanctions on Iran, worsening the situation. Additionally, Washington's withdrawal from the Iranian nuclear deal in 2018 heightened tensions, as Iran viewed this withdrawal as a threat to its national security.

Impact & Consequences

If the Iranian reports regarding the attack on the US ship are confirmed, it could lead to military escalation in the region. The United States may take military action in response to this attack, potentially escalating the conflict further.

This incident could also impact global oil prices, as any escalation in the region may lead to price increases due to fears of disruption in oil shipments. Consequently, global markets are closely monitoring the situation.

Regional Significance

The neighboring Arab countries to the Strait of Hormuz, such as the United Arab Emirates and Saudi Arabia, are critically important in this context. Any escalation in the conflict could affect their security and stability, as these countries heavily rely on oil exports.

Furthermore, any military escalation could lead to an influx of refugees into neighboring Arab countries, increasing pressure on these nations. Therefore, the situation in the Strait of Hormuz is a sensitive issue that requires urgent international attention.
